Subject: Key rotation for the digest scheduler — action needed before Thursday

Hi all,

As part of our quarterly rotation, the credential used by the Lettermill batch digest scheduler is being replaced. The old key stops working Thursday at 09:00 local time. Please update the scheduler config in both staging and production, and confirm the nightly digest job completes a dry run before the cutoff. Nothing else in the pipeline changes. For the review branch, the new key is included below.

service key, tadup-tahog: zpat7_wB1tnEL

Checklist item 4 — Oakmote firmware channel. Before you flip the Oakmote update channel from canary to broad, double-check that the rollback image is actually pinned — last cycle it pointed at a stale build and we had a fun evening. Also confirm the staged rollout percentage resets to 5%, not whatever the last push left it at. When both look good, promote the release and verify the artifact against the build token below.

pipeline stamp: htk21_104c5ba7d0df6b2897cd5

Subject: Proctorline queue cut-over complete

Team — the exam-proctoring queue moved to the new Vigilum backend last night. All pending sessions were drained before the switch, so no candidates were affected. Support impact: session IDs now carry a new prefix, and stuck-session escalations should go to the Vigilum on-call rotation rather than the legacy channel. Expect a few tickets about slower initial connection while caches warm. Old queue stays read-only for thirty days. For reference, the new service runs with the following configuration.

deployment values, yadug-bawif:
[framir]
team = pelox
access_code = ac_a38ab2
owner = tamion.julael
host = framir.tolvaqlabs.test
port = 11211
peer = tammir.zemvargrid.local
salt = 2215ef03
pin = 1541